6 Signs Your ServiceNow Instance Needs a Health Check

ServiceNow

5 MIN READ

February 28, 2026

Loading

servicenow health checkups

ServiceNow is one of the most powerful platforms in enterprise IT, and most organisations that implement it see real results early on. Workflows get faster, teams stop relying on email chains, and service delivery becomes measurable for the first time.

But implementation is the start of the journey, not the finish line. With time, every organisation adds customisations, activates new modules, builds integrations, and adjusts workflows to match how the business actually operates. Each of those decisions makes sense individually. Together, without a structured review process, they create a layer of complexity that is difficult to see and expensive to fix later.

Performance starts to slip, upgrades take longer than they should, and users raise complaints that take weeks to trace back to a root cause. Either way, the platform stops running the way it was designed to.

This is what a ServiceNow health check is for. Not a crisis, not a failure, but the natural drift that happens to every instance that grows without regular oversight. Catching it early is what separates teams that get long-term value from the platform from those that spend their time managing it instead of using it.

Common Signs Your ServiceNow Platform Needs Optimization

Sign 1: Degraded Instance Performance and Workflow Delays

Performance issues in ServiceNow build up as the instance grows. More users, more customisations, more data, and the configuration decisions that worked fine at go-live start showing their cost.

ServiceNow performance issues most commonly trace back to inefficient GlideRecord queries that scan entire tables instead of using indexed fields, Business Rules that trigger on every record update regardless of relevance, and client-side scripts that run on page load even when they are not needed for that specific form or user.

The visible result is slow forms, reports that take too long to generate, and workflows that stall without a clear error. Users notice before the admin team does, and by the time it gets flagged, the underlying configuration debt has usually been building for months. Instances that feel slower than they did a year ago are worth a formal ServiceNow audit.

Pro Tip: If you are unsure whether performance issues are configuration-related or something deeper, a ServiceNow consulting partner can run a quick audit and tell you exactly where the problem sits.

Sign 2: Unused Modules and Orphaned Workflows

Over time, most ServiceNow instances accumulate applications that were activated for a project and never decommissioned, and workflows that were built but never fully deployed. These do not sit quietly in the background. Unused modules add to the instance footprint, contribute to slower performance, and create confusion during upgrades when nobody is certain whether a module is still in use.

Orphaned workflows are a particular risk. A workflow that is partially built and never closed out can trigger unexpectedly, conflict with active automation, or simply clutter the development environment in a way that slows down every change review.

A ServiceNow health check surfaces these quickly. Knowing what is active, what is dormant, and what can be safely removed is one of the fastest ways to reduce instance complexity without changing any live configuration.

servicenowhealth check 6 warning signs

Sign 3: Frequent Manual Fixes and Workarounds

When admins find themselves regularly applying quick-fix scripts, undocumented patches, or manual workarounds to keep things running, that pattern is worth paying attention to. Individual fixes feel manageable at the moment. Across six or twelve months, they accumulate into a layer of undocumented changes that nobody on the team fully understands.

This is one of the clearest signs of poor ServiceNow governance. Changes made outside a structured review process introduce dependencies that are difficult to trace, create conflicts during upgrades, and make it harder for any new team member to understand how the instance actually works.

ServiceNow maintenance done properly means every change is documented, reviewed, and tested before it reaches production. When that process breaks down, the manual fix cycle is usually where it first shows up.

If your team is navigating this pattern, this blog on why ServiceNow implementations fail is worth a read.

Sign 4: Customisations That Block Every Upgrade

Every time a new ServiceNow upgrade comes out, the process takes longer than it should. Skipped records pile up. Deprecated APIs that were overridden years ago conflict with the new baseline. Testing takes weeks because nobody is certain what the customisations will break.

According to Forrester, 75% of technology decision-makers expect their technical debt to reach a moderate or high level of severity by 2026. Over-customized ServiceNow instances are one of the most direct contributors to that debt. ServiceNow customization problems compound at upgrade time. When teams override baseline functions, modify out-of-box tables, or write Script Includes outside scoped applications, each of those decisions becomes a liability in the next release.

According to ServiceNow’s HealthScan datasheet, a ServiceNow health scan performed during upgrade planning can help teams complete upgrades in weeks, rather than months. ServiceNow upgrade readiness starts with knowing exactly what has been changed and why.

When the upgrade cycle starts feeling like a project in itself, the customisation layer is worth auditing before the next release lands.

Sign 5: Recurring Service Portal Complaints

When users raise complaints about the Service Portal, the instinct is to treat it as a design problem. The form is too long, the navigation is confusing, and the page takes too long to load. Those observations are usually accurate, and they almost always point to something deeper in the configuration.

Behind most recurring portal complaints is a configuration issue. Workflows designed for a previous version of the portal have not been updated. Form field conditions are triggering incorrectly because of conflicting Business Rules. ACL rules are hiding information that users expect to see, so they raise a ticket instead of self-serving.

The portal is where users interact with the instance every day. Complaints that come up more than once are worth treating as a ServiceNow audit trigger, not just a helpdesk item.

Sign 6: No Formal Review in Over Six Months

This sign carries the most long-term risk. When nobody on the team can answer with confidence when the instance was last formally reviewed, that gap itself is worth paying attention to.

Update sets accumulate with no documentation of what changed or why. Scripts get written to solve immediate problems without a review of whether they conflict with existing logic. New modules get activated without a check of their impact on performance or security configurations. Poor ServiceNow governance at this level is one of the most common reasons instances become difficult to maintain and expensive to upgrade.

ServiceNow best practices recommend running a health check before every major upgrade and at least once per quarter. A formal ServiceNow audit on a regular cadence is what keeps the instance manageable as it grows.

For a closer look at how platform health connects to long-term returns, read our blog on ServiceNow ROI.

when to schedule a servicenow health check

Real-World Impact of ServiceNow Instance Optimization

In a study commissioned by ServiceNow, Forrester found that modernising IT Service Management on the platform delivered a 20% increase in IT productivity, a 25% reduction in P1 incidents, and an ROI of 195% over three years. These outcomes came from organisations that invested in getting their existing platform to work the way it was designed to.

The specific improvements teams can expect after a ServiceNow health check include:

  • Faster upgrade cycles: With technical debt addressed and deprecated customisations resolved, upgrades move from months-long projects to predictable, contained processes.
  • Fewer high-priority incidents: Clean configurations reduce the unexpected failures that generate P1 tickets and pull engineering teams into reactive firefighting.
  • Improved IT productivity: When workflows run as designed, and integrations stop throwing errors, the team spends less time on manual fixes and more time on work that moves the business forward.
  • Better reporting accuracy: Standardised processes and clean data flows mean dashboards and reports reflect what is actually happening, not what the system last captured before a script failure.
  • Higher user engagement with the portal: A portal that works consistently encourages users to self-serve, which reduces ticket volume and frees the support team for more complex requests.

How Ksolves Approaches a ServiceNow Health Check

Ksolves ServiceNow consulting services include AI-assisted health checks that surface configuration risks, ServiceNow technical debt, and upgrade blockers before they compound. AI tools scan configuration patterns, flag deprecated usage, and cross-reference findings against upgrade risk profiles before a consultant reviews them. The findings that reach your team are already prioritised by severity and mapped to a remediation plan.

For organisations dealing with over-customized or poor ServiceNow instance optimization, the difference between a manual review and an AI-assisted audit is the time it takes to go from findings to action. A shorter assessment cycle means a clearer plan and an instance ready to scale as your business grows.

If you are seeing any of the signs above, connect with the Ksolves ServiceNow consulting team to discuss a health check for your instance.

Frequently Asked Questions

What is a ServiceNow health check?

A ServiceNow health check is a structured diagnostic review of your platform configuration. ServiceNow’s health scan tool evaluates hundreds of KPIs across five categories: security, upgradability, performance, manageability, and usability. The output is a scored ServiceNow assessment with prioritised recommendations for improvement.

How often should I run a ServiceNow health check?

ServiceNow best practices recommend running a health check before every major upgrade and at least once per quarter. Teams that wait until something breaks typically find that the underlying issues have been accumulating for much longer than the visible symptom suggests.

Is ServiceNow HealthScan free?

Yes. ServiceNow offers the end-to-end health scan at no cost to customers. It is available through the ServiceNow Customer Success programme.

What does a healthy ServiceNow instance score look like?

A healthy instance typically scores between 80 and 85% on the health scan scorecard. Scores below this range indicate areas where configuration, customisation, or ServiceNow governance decisions are creating risk or limiting performance.

loading

AUTHOR

Ksolvesdev
Ksolvesdev

ServiceNow

Leave a Comment

Your email address will not be published. Required fields are marked *

(Text Character Limit 350)